MOON LAKE, UTAH

Period of Record General Climate Summary - Heating Degree Days

Station:(425815) MOON LAKE
From Year=1935 To Year=1969
Heating Degree Days for Selected Base Temperature (F)
Base Jan. Feb. Mar. Apr. May Jun. Jul. Aug. Sep. Oct. Nov. Dec. Annual
65 1500 1319 1232 832 622 352 146 192 425 727 1027 1338 9711
60 1345 1177 1077 682 467 213 41 72 278 572 877 1183 7984
57 1252 1092 984 592 375 144 11 30 199 479 787 1090 7036
55 1190 1036 922 532 316 105 4 16 153 417 727 1028 6446
50 1035 894 767 384 182 39 0 3 67 270 577 873 5091
Heating Degree Day units are computed as the difference between the base temperature and the daily average temperature. (Base Temp. - Daily Ave. Temp.) One unit is accumulated for each degree Fahrenheit the average temperature is below the base temperature. Negative numbers are discarded. Example: If the days high temperature was 65 and the low temperature was 31, the base 50 heating degree day units is 50 - ((65 + 31) / 2) = 2. This is done for each day of the month and summed.

Months with 5 or more missing days are not considered
Years with 1 or more missing months are not considered
